If you're freelance, you can deduct your gas mileage any type of time you leave your business locationeven if that organization place is your house. The gas mileage has to be "common and necessary" to be a write-off.




But if you take a 10-mile detour on the means back so you can visit your preferred bubble tea shop, that added mileage can not be deducted. You can only deduct the 30 miles you took a trip for business. You subtract mileage from your tax obligations using a conventional per-mile rate. For the 2023 tax obligation year, the rate was 65.5 cents per mile.
